## Parcel-Tracking Webhook (Shipwren)

The tracking webhook fires on every scan event and must stay backward-compatible across releases. Before each deploy, replay the golden event set against staging and confirm signature verification passes. Rotating the webhook signing secret is a release-manager duty; the rotation tool will prompt for the recovery passphrase shown on the next line.

vault phrase of tajeg-tageg = pelix-druix-holius-briael-zorwyn-frawyn-fraox-norok-drueth-aldiel

Ticket: Sign-off required — GateTally turnstile counter drift fix

Reviewer, please examine carefully. The GateTally counter at Ashford Vale Stadium was under-reporting entries during peak ingress because the debounce window swallowed legitimate rapid rotations. This change shortens the debounce to 120ms and adds a reconciliation pass against the ticket-scan log every five minutes. Includes unit tests and a replay of last season's busiest fixture. Deployment blocked until formal sign-off is recorded from the accountable engineer.

named custodian: Brivan Eliath Quenox Frador

Subject: Studio access for Thursday

Hello,

This is the front desk at Corvessa House. The training-video studio on level 2 is booked for your crew from 09:00. Please sign in on arrival, wear your contractor lanyards visibly, and avoid the live-edit suite next door. The studio door uses a keypad, and the current entry code is shown directly below.

turnstile pass: bdg-QZV-3

## Account Recovery — Sproutline Plugin Portal

Plugin authors locked out of their Sproutline developer account should trigger recovery from the portal login page. The watering-schedule API tokens are revoked automatically during recovery; reissue them afterward. To restore your signing identity for published plugins, enter the recovery passphrase below.

unlock words, kawip-hadup: tamath-wenir-sorius-sorius-wenix-novvan-istox-wenius-feneth-briiel

Fan-out backpressure for the Quillet notifier: when the queue depth crosses the soft limit, the dispatcher sheds low-priority pushes and batches the rest at 500ms intervals. Reviewer should confirm the shed counter is exported and that retries respect the jitter window. Once merged, the release artifact gets re-signed by the pipeline, which expects the deploy key shown below.

deploy key for bawep-yawif: bky6_GQhaSt